    Quote Originally Posted by Obysuca View Post
    >_> J40.00 is a bit much imo, I remember when expansions were 20.00 (pre-WoW), so no, they haven't been "that way for ages", they've just been like it since WoW.
    You mean like FFXI? Chains of Promathia was $29.99 released in 2004 before WoW was released.

    http://www.square-enix.com/na/compan...2004/21092004/

    So $10 increase after 10 years? Now how much content is in Heavensward we don't know but if there is more content than CoP, price may be justified.

    Edit: Actually, funny enough the original price was $49.99, so in fact, Heavensward is cheaper than pre-WoW expansions at launch lol.

    The Chains of Promathia expansion pack will be available in North America for $29.99 (USD). With the popularity of the title and the desire to expand the PlayOnline user base even further, FINAL FANTASY XI for Windows is now available for a suggested retail price of $29.99 (USD). The successful sales and subscription base in Japan and North America have allowed for a lower MSRP, which was reduced from an original MSRP of $49.99 (USD).

    Quote Originally Posted by Zenaku View Post

    Vs COP which i believe had every mission and story on it from day one.
    CoP did not have all story missions out on day 1, they had the first 2 chapters out of 8 total. The rest were added in subsequent patches, the final story line mission was added over a year later. CoP had no new level cap, no new jobs, just new areas and story missions and a handfull new new items mostly lower lvl items for CoP level capped areas. So we are actually getting a lot more in Heavensward, with a new race, 3 new jobs, and storyline missions, new areas and flying mounts.
